Description

A theta-logistic population model Variant (See Aanes et al. 2002 for model formulation), including the possibility for harvest. Harvest is applied as a pulse removing a pre-determined number of individuals. After harvest the population grows according to the parameters governing the dynamics of the (model) population. Note that this type of model become the Gompertz model as theta approaches 0.
